Abstract

Training and motivation are known as some of the many alternatives that stimulate employee performance. 53 Steps Café, one of North Sumatra's most well-known cafés, seems to be negatively affected by two problems: poor customer service and frequent employee absences. This research aims to discover the influence that training and motivation might have on employee performance at 53 Steps Café Medan. Osemeke and Adegboyega (2017, p. 169) describe “three central motivational paradigms achievement, power, and affiliation”. It is believed that people are more motivated when these needs are met. Quantitative descriptive and causal studies were used to develop this study. Data for this study was gathered through a direct interview with the management of 53 Steps Café Medan, direct on-site observation, and the distribution of a questionnaire to a total of 35 53 Steps Café Medan employees. Saturated sampling approach was used to determine the sample in this study. Research findings show that partially, motivation has no influence on employee performance, while training is proven to have positive influence. However, training and motivation have significant simultaneous influence on the employee performance.
